Output 64c35f4d3ab76b970da230d616660390240a7c063c55e86a4cceb65d211ac8a4:5

value
3114717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c15a95727ccfeeae997ac1d080cf97921b0e899b OP_EQUAL
address
3KKNrSNbtBWodas2KXR7AwefETT8MdAXSQ
transaction
64c35f4d3ab76b970da230d616660390240a7c063c55e86a4cceb65d211ac8a4
spent
true